Air Fryer Tempura Shrimp Recipe

This recipe serves 4 people.

Ingredients:

  • 1 pound peeled and deveined shrimp
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1 cup cornstarch
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1 cup ice water
  • 1/2 cup vegetable oil
  • Your favorite dipping sauce (such as soy sauce, wasabi, or sweet chili sauce)

Instructions:

  1. In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, cornstarch, baking powder, salt, and pepper.
  2. Slowly add the ice water to the dry ingredients, whisking constantly until a smooth batter forms. It should be thick but pourable.
  3. Heat the vegetable oil in a small saucepan over medium heat.
  4. Dip each shrimp into the batter, ensuring it is completely coated. Gently shake off any excess batter.
  5. Place the battered shrimp in a single layer in the air fryer basket. Avoid overcrowding the basket.
  6. Air fry at 400°F (200°C) for 5-7 minutes, or until the shrimp are golden brown and cooked through.
  7. Carefully remove the shrimp from the air fryer and serve immediately with your favorite dipping sauce.

Optimal Air Fryer Settings and Cooking Time

The ideal air fryer settings for tempura shrimp are 400°F (200°C) for 5-7 minutes. However, the cooking time may vary depending on the size and thickness of the shrimp and the capacity of your air fryer. To ensure the shrimp are cooked through, insert a food thermometer into the thickest part of a shrimp.

It should register an internal temperature of 145°F (63°C).

Preserving Crispness and Flavor

Storing and reheating leftover tempura shrimp can be a challenge, as the delicate batter can easily become soggy. To maintain its crispness and flavor, follow these steps:

  • Cool Completely:Allow the shrimp to cool completely before storing them. This prevents condensation from forming and softening the batter.
  • Airtight Container:Store the cooled shrimp in an airtight container to prevent them from drying out or absorbing odors from the refrigerator.
  • Reheating:To reheat, place the shrimp in a preheated air fryer at 350°F (175°C) for 3-5 minutes, or until heated through. You can also reheat them in a skillet over medium heat, but be careful not to overcook them, as this can make the batter tough.
